What Is The Cause Of Presence Of Blood In Urine And Burning Urination?

hi 3 nights ago I had sex which felt uncomfortable the next day I had severe pain below where even sitting down was uncomfortable. The following day from that the pain was fine but I have now started to get a burning feeling towards the end when im urinating and although my underware is clean when I wipe there is very light pink blood stains and I can see little bits of blood in my urine. Also I have had a marina coil for 4 years. Do u think the coil has moved out of place?

Possibility of any urinary tract infection after the intercourse and any minor injury may occur in genitalia.

kindly do a urine culture to fix the issues.

blood stain indicates both of the above reason.
visit a physician to rule out the cause.
